Main content
Sorry, this episode is not currently available

Llama drama

Shourjo reports on a drama about a llama near Hollingworth Lake plus more on this year's weather which is set to be the warmest on record.

3 hours

Last on

Tue 30 Dec 201415:00

Broadcast

  • Tue 30 Dec 201415:00